当前位置:首页 » 文件管理 » delphiftp服务器

delphiftp服务器

发布时间: 2023-08-30 09:19:37

⑴ delphi7 用delphi实现文件的ftp批量传递有没有比较好的办法在传递的时候讲所有提交的文件重命名

FTP分为两端:服务器端+客户端。如果用delphi编程,既可以两者都可以自己编写,也可以服务器端用现在的软件,客户端自己写代码。

从你的问题来看,传输的时候将文件名重命名,据我的理解,传输的过程中是无法更名的,可以考虑在传输开始前、结束后进行重命名。

比如:

如果是下载数据,当数据下载前或下载后都可以进行文件更名操作。
如果是上传,可以在上传之前就将文件进行更名,更名后再上传。

⑵ Delphi中,怎么使用FTP主动下传文件

delphi 提供了 indy 组件包,其中 TIdFTP可以实现通过以 FTP 方式进行文件的上传与下载。示例代码如下:

procereTForm1.Button2Click(Sender:TObject);
var
tt:TIdFTPListItems;
t:TIdFTPListItem;
i:integer;
tfname:String;
begin
IdFTP1.TransferType:=ftBinary;//指定为二进制文件或文本文件ftASCII
fori:=0toIdFTP1.DirectoryListing.Count-1do
begin
tt:=IdFTP1.DirectoryListing;//得到当前目录下文件及目录列表
t:=tt.Items[i];//得到一个文件相关信息
Label1.Caption:=t.Text;//取出一个文件信息内容
tfname:=t.FileName;
showmessage(t.OwnerName+''+t.GroupName+''+t.FileName+''+t.LinkedItemName);
ifIdFTP1.DirectoryListing.Items[i].ItemType=ditFilethen//如果是文件
begin
IdFTP1.Get(tfname,'d:FTPtest'+tfname,True,True);//下载到本地,并为覆盖,且支持断点续传
end;
end;
end;

⑶ DELPHI实现服务端与客户端之间进行文件夹传输

文件传输可以用FTP协议,delphi4,delphi7都有简易ftp的控件,另外,若服务器是公用服务器,也可以用标准下载方式。

⑷ 怎样把本地文件共享到服务器上

你右击文件 属性

选择共享,共享以后 在服务器端,运行里输入 \IP地址

热点内容
自己怎么搭建网站服务器 发布:2025-08-22 00:36:54 浏览:141
按键精灵只能做手游脚本吗 发布:2025-08-22 00:31:22 浏览:152
php网站制作 发布:2025-08-22 00:31:19 浏览:488
java的http编程 发布:2025-08-21 23:56:32 浏览:988
大学数据库试题 发布:2025-08-21 23:56:28 浏览:801
沾福卡的算法 发布:2025-08-21 23:38:26 浏览:337
java极光 发布:2025-08-21 23:38:14 浏览:709
php路由框架 发布:2025-08-21 23:32:17 浏览:771
超微ipmi无法解析服务器dns地址 发布:2025-08-21 23:31:14 浏览:162
私服魔域脚本 发布:2025-08-21 23:29:34 浏览:55